In the May newsletter we mentioned that a new controller would be installed
at the well house. This has been completed and we are now in compliance
with the DEQ requirements that resulted from their last site review. Two DEQ
(now called EGLE) water quality engineers were here for another site review on Wednesday
July 31st. We meet all their requirements.
There are some water leaks in the well house that are causing corrosion and deterioration of the pumping equipment. The board has authorized repairs that will run $985 and was com-pleted on July 31
st. There was no interruption of our water supply. Our water quality continues
to be excellent.
